About J A Stapleton

J A Stapleton is a scholar working on Physiology, Molecular Biology, Public Health, Environmental and Occupational Health, Cellular and Molecular Neuroscience and Pulmonary and Respiratory Medicine, having authored 34 papers that have together received 1.8k indexed citations. Recurring topics across this work include Smoking Behavior and Cessation (19 papers), Nicotinic Acetylcholine Receptors Study (7 papers), Obesity, Physical Activity, Diet (3 papers), Air Quality and Health Impacts (2 papers), Obesity and Health Practices (2 papers), Carcinogens and Genotoxicity Assessment (2 papers), Asthma and respiratory diseases (2 papers) and Health Policy Implementation Science (1 paper). The work is most often cited by research in Physiology (1.2k citations), Applied Psychology (157 citations), Periodontics (76 citations), Speech and Hearing (100 citations) and Public Health, Environmental and Occupational Health (284 citations). J A Stapleton has collaborated with scholars based in United Kingdom, Bulgaria and Canada. Frequent co-authors include Michael A. Russell, G Sutherland, C Feyerabend, Robert West, M. J. Jarvis, Michael Belcher, Peter Hájek, G Gustavsson, W. Taylor and Richard Palmer. Their work appears in journals such as Nicotine & Tobacco Research, Psychopharmacology, European Journal of Clinical Investigation, Journal of Epidemiology & Community Health and Grass and Forage Science.
